What is recorded here

Freestanding gable-fronted double-height former Roman Catholic church, built 1874, with four-bay side elevations and single-storey lean-to sacristy to rear. Deconsecrated and extended to left, c.1970, with gable-fronted double-height replica, to accommodate use as factory. Pitched slate roof with cut-stone bellcote. Rendered walls with quoins. Lancet openings with timber Y-tracery and leaded stained glass. Entrance altered to accommodate use as factory.
